A kind of payment assistance that some alcohol and drug treatment centers may offer their clients is an adjustable fee scale. If a client can afford some degree of self-payment, these programs provide assistance on a case-by-case basis which can greatly reduce the cost of treatment so that it can be afforded by that particular person. How this typically works is the individual will need to satisfy certain requirements for payment help and will have to provide information about how many dependents they have, proof of income, what their household overhead is, and the like. Based off this information intake admins can determine what that client will need to pay, using a sliding scale.
For example, if an individual in Catonsville only makes $18,000/year, has 3 dependents and $800 in monthly bills they may only need to pay $1000 for rehab, whereas an individual who is single and makes $30 a year with no overhead must pay much more.
Even in cases where sliding fee scales are available, people may need to seek additional assistance to pay this lesser fee. Intake administrators can help clients or family who are paying for rehab apply for financing from a third party lender, and in mostcases this money doesn't need to be repaid until after the client finishes rehabilitation.
